How to interpret rumored or leaked dates

Leaked schedules and unofficial announcements often circulate ahead of studio confirmations. While timely, these should be treated as speculative until corroborated by reliable industry sources or official press materials.

  • Check primary sources: studio press releases and official talent announcements.
  • Consult industry trackers like IMDbPro, Studio System, or reputable trade outlets.
  • Cross‑reference multiple outlets; one outlet’s leak may differ from another’s.
  • Treat social‑media posts and anonymous forums as unverified until confirmed.

Key terms and production context

Clarifying common phrases helps you evaluate how firm a reported date really is.

Term Meaning Implication for release date
Greenlit Project approved with budget and talent locked Production typically begins within 6–12 months
In production Principal photography underway Release usually 12–24 months later
Post‑production Filming complete; editing and effects ongoing Release within 3–6 months
Tentative date Placeholder on studio calendar Subject to change based on production and market
